Showing all 5 results

395.06 /mtr
143.75 Meter left in stock
Buy
395.06 /mtr
65 Meter left in stock
Buy
677.25 /mtr
9 Meter left in stock
Buy
677.25 /mtr
51.5 Meter left in stock
Buy
395.06 /mtr
110 Meter left in stock
Buy